Pulse Analysis

The rise of generative AI in recruitment marks a shift from static career pages to dynamic, data‑informed storytelling. By analyzing candidate behavior and market trends, AI platforms craft copy and visuals that resonate with specific talent segments, preserving a cohesive brand voice across LinkedIn, Instagram, and niche job boards. This capability not only amplifies reach but also transforms employer branding into a measurable, performance‑driven discipline, where engagement metrics directly inform creative strategy.

Operationally, AI slashes content creation time from days to minutes, enabling recruiters to launch campaigns in real time as market conditions evolve. Automated design templates and language models free teams from repetitive tasks, allowing them to focus on strategic planning and human insight. For smaller organizations, the technology removes traditional barriers—high‑cost agencies and specialized skill sets—by delivering professional‑grade assets on a subscription basis, effectively democratizing access to top‑tier employer branding.

Looking ahead, advances in multimodal AI and real‑time personalization promise hyper‑targeted candidate journeys, where landing pages and video narratives adapt instantly to individual preferences. However, firms must balance efficiency with authenticity, ensuring human oversight to maintain ethical standards and genuine voice. Strategic adoption involves selecting tools aligned with business goals, upskilling recruitment staff, and integrating analytics to continuously refine content performance. Companies that master this blend of creativity, data, and technology will secure a sustainable talent advantage in an increasingly competitive hiring landscape.
